KENNY v. KELLY

No. 12476.

254 S.W.2d 535 (1953)

KENNY et al. v. KELLY et al.

Court of Civil Appeals of Texas, San Antonio.

January 21, 1953.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Dobbins & Howard and Parker, Smith & Rice, San Antonio, for appellants.

Carl Wright Johnson, Edward P. Fahey, Eskridge, Groce & Hebdon, Harvey L. Hardy and C. J. Matthews, San Antonio, for appellees.


NORVELL, Justice.

Joseph T. Kenny and approximately fifty other landholders in the vicinity, sought to enjoin W. A. Kelly, doing business as Kelly Construction Company, the City of San Antonio, and Guy A. Thompson, trustee in bankruptcy for the International-Great Northern Railroad Company, from constructing or permitting the construction of a spur railroad track onto New City Block 7301 of the City of San Antonio, and from recognizing as valid a 1949 amendment of...
